Ingredients

  • ½ cup ground flaxseed
  • ½ cup whole flaxseed
  • ¼ cup chia seeds
  • ½ cup sunflower seeds
  • ½ cup sesame seeds hulled
  • 1 ½ tsp dried oregano or rosemary
  • ½ tsp sea salt
  • 1 ½ cups water

Step-by-Step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 160°C (320°F). Line a baking tray with parchment paper.
  • Mix dry ingredients in a large bowl.
    ½ cup ground flaxseed, ½ cup whole flaxseed, ¼ cup chia seeds, ½ cup sunflower seeds, ½ cup sesame seeds, 1 ½ tsp dried oregano or rosemary, ½ tsp sea salt
  • Add water and stir until thickened into a gel-like dough. Let sit 10 minutes.
    1 ½ cups water
  • Spread evenly on the tray, smoothing with a spatula to about 3–4 mm thick.
  • Score crackers with a knife to your desired size.
  • Bake for 30–35 minutes, flipping halfway through if needed.
  • Cool completely, then break apart and store in an airtight container.

Notes & Tips

 

  • For crispier crackers, leave them in the warm oven (turned off) for 10 minutes after baking.
  • Store in a sealed container for up to a week, or freeze for longer storage.
  • Swap herbs for variety: try garlic powder, fennel seed, or a pinch of cumin.
